Abstract

This paper aims to present a novel concept roadmap - the patent roadmap - and suggest an advanced patent roadmapping process, based on the Generative Topographic Mapping (GTM) and Bass diffusion model. The process for patent roadmapping is composed of two modules: Developing the GTM-based patent map and determining the appearance time of the emerging patent through Bass model. The result of this research is meaningful knowledge from analyzing a vast store of patent data with quantitative methods and automated tools. It can serve as an effective patent planning tool, and proposes a strategic Research and Business Development (R&BD) for both firms and governments.
